What Is Austin TX Alcohol Detox?

For many individuals with alcohol use disorder (AUD), detox is the initial step in treatment. Supervised medical detox helps you manage distressing withdrawal symptoms, helps in reducing the risk of withdrawal problems such as seizures, and keeps you as safe and comfy as possible.

Degrees of Alcohol Withdrawal Symptoms

Alcohol withdrawal symptoms range from mild to severe. Which symptoms you have, how bad they are, and the length of time they last will depend upon aspects such as how much and how typically you drink, your age, and your overall health.

Symptoms of mild alcohol withdrawal include:

  • Anxiety.
  • Headache.
  • Insomnia.
  • Trembling.
  • Heart palpitations.
  • Intestinal disturbances.

In addition to the relatively mild symptoms above, moderate withdrawal might also include:

  • Hyperthermia (elevated body temperature level).
  • Diaphoresis (sweating).
  • Tachycardia (quick heartbeat).
  • Increased systolic blood pressure.
  • Tachypnea (fast, shallow breathing).
  • Confusion.

Severe alcohol withdrawal can result in seizures and delirium tremens (DTs). Delirium tremens symptoms might include:

  • Fever.
  • Body tremblings.
  • Severe confusion or disorientation.
  • Hallucinations.
  • Agitation.
  • Seizures.

If you believe you or somebody you understand is experiencing this type of withdrawal, seek medical attention instantly.

When Will Alcohol Withdrawal Symptoms Start?

Some symptoms of mild alcohol withdrawal might be experienced as soon as 8 hours after the last time alcohol is taken in.

Depending upon the magnitude of physical dependence, extra withdrawal symptoms might continue to develop beyond 24 hours, with some potentially severe effects emerging in the series of 2 to 4 days after abstinence.

The Length Of Time Will Alcohol Withdrawal Symptoms Last?

The alcohol withdrawal symptoms timeline is various for everybody however a full series of alcohol withdrawal symptoms might persist for as low as a couple of hours up through numerous weeks after withdrawal has actually started. The most severe symptoms typically establish as many as two to three days after the last drink.

Oftentimes, physical symptoms of alcohol withdrawal will mostly begin to decrease and completely and deal with within 5 to 7 days.

Austin Alcohol Withdrawal Treatment

The kind of detox program, alcohol detox timeline, or level of strength required for effective alcohol withdrawal management will depend upon the seriousness of the addiction, the magnitude of alcoholism, and the risk of experiencing a complicated withdrawal.

A doctor or other treatment professional may examine for the above aspects prior to making a suggestion for the level of detox care and detox timeline needed to keep an individual safe and comfy.

Outpatient alcohol detox may be a great suitable for people at low danger for severe withdrawal. Withdrawal progress is monitored through frequent check-up appointments within outpatient scientific settings (e.g., medical professional’s office), permitting the level of care to be escalated if required.

Austin inpatient alcohol detox might be matched to individuals at threat for moderate to severe withdrawal who need 24-hour medically-supervised detox services. Staff at these detox programs will monitor healing development and frequently assess for any withdrawal problems to make sure the patient is not in danger.

Benzodiazepines or other sedative medications might be administered throughout the process. Inpatient detoxification also works as a method to keep people somewhat gotten rid of from possibly activating social and ecological stimuli that might increase the risk of relapse.
